Summary

Miyu Yamashita shot a 2-under 70 at TPC Boston, tying for the lead in the FM Championship at 9-under 135. She is joined at the top by Hyo Joo Kim and Allisen Corpuz, who each posted scores of 67. This performance follows her recent triumph in Canada, where she set a tour scoring record. Other notable competitors include Morgane Metraux and Ruoning Yin, each one stroke behind the leaders. The tournament features a $4.4 million purse, the largest outside the majors on the LPGA Tour, and acts as a lead-in to the Solheim Cup matches.
